Description
The Alignment spec is basically totally done and stable and ready to go, except for a ton of details about baseline alignment; dbaron has a blocking issue, i18n wants diagrams, and impls keep filing issues about subtle mistakes.
In the interest of not holding back all the good stable parts of this spec from getting to CR and beyond, can we punt baseline to the next level?
